Vocalists Scot Albertson, Mychelle Colleary, John DeMarco, Laurie Krauz, Ejaye Tracey, and Alysha Umphress will perform with the Barry Levitt Trio at Iridium Jazz Club, Wednesday, April 25 at 10PM. All slated performers are 2007 MAC Nominees for Jazz Vocalist.

The MAC Awards celebrate the best of live entertainment in Cabaret, Jazz & Comedy in New York. This year, Lifetime Achievement Awards will go to actress/singer Dody Goodman and cabaret impresario Jan Wallman. Time Out New York will present their "Special Achievement MAC Award" to Leslie Kritzer for her Joe's Pub Show, "Leslie Kritzer Is Patti LuPone at Les Mouches." Also partaking in this years awards are stars Joan Rivers, Rex Reed, Lee Roy Reams, Charles Busch, Stephen Schwartz, Carol Hall, David Zippel, Henry Krieger, John Wallowitch, Melissa Errico, Sally Mayes, Leslie Kritzer, Jamie DeRoy, Julie Gold, John Bucchino, David Friedman, Sidney Myer, KT Sullivan, Mark Nadler, and Alysha Umphress.
